Replying to: autoedu (Jun 14, 2005 9:41 pm) http://www.roadandtrack.com/assets/download/VolvoS40.pdf.pdf http://www.roadandtrack.com/assets/download/0411_audi_mb_data.pdf The Price S40 T5 = $30,095 Audi S4 = $50,790 C55 AMG = $60,525 The engine S40 = Turbocharged inline 5 S4 = dohc 5-valve/V-8 C55 = sohc 3-valve/V-8 The Acceleration 0-60 S40 = 6.5 S4 = 5.5 C55 = 5.0 0-1/4mile S40 = 15.0 S4 = 14.6 C55 = 13.5 Braking (both S40 T5 & Audi S4 wearing Continental ContiSportContact2 tires) 60-0 S40 = 110 ft S4 = 143 ft C55 = 135 ft 80-0 S40 = 197 ft S4 = 256 ft C55 = 232 ft The Handling Skidpad S40 = .84g S4 = .82g C55 = .86g Slalom S40 = 63.7 mph S4 = 66.1 mph C55 = 67.6 mph Interior noise (quietness) Idle in neutral S40 = 43 dba S4 = 49 dba C55 = 50 dba 70mph S40 = 70 dba S4 = 73 dba C55 = 73 dba Summary: The price difference is day and night the S40 T5 cost half as much as the Mercedes C55 AMG ($30K less) and $20K less than the Audi S4. Acceleration is a bit slower from 0-60 than the other two but very close in the time to distance mark (this is impressive given the Volvo smaller engine). The braking difference show a hughe advantage for the S40 T5, in worst case scenario, this difference could be a matter of life and death. In the handling area all three cars are neck and neck with insignificant difference. And as far as quietness and comfort, the S40 has an edge over the other 2 (partly due to smaller engine result in lesser cabin noise). Comparing S40 T5 with Audis S4 and Mercedes C55 AMG to begin with some would say this is a mismatch. I would say the only mismatch is the price. The stats are in and the numbers don't lie, the S40 T5 is a very well built performance car with very respectable numbers, putting it in the same league with the top of the line Audi 4 series and Mercedes C-class. There is no test number for the BMW 3 Series yet, but from these result I would assume that only the M3 is competitive enough for comparison. So in the same price range (under $35K) I wonder if the others (A4, C-class, BMW 325/330) can measure up to the S40 T5. Anyone found data on 3 Series?

The difference between 6.5 and 5 to sixty is astronomical. Same for 4mph difference through the slalom. There is a diminishing return for the dollar with regard to performance. Yes, you might not feel it justifies twice the price, but to the sports car buyer it does. Even lack of turbo lag matters. And there's more to driving experience than some test numbers--i wager that if you drove an s40t5 and a c55AMG or s4 back to back, you'd see where some of the money went. Part of it is standard equipment, of course--a $30K s40 is comparatively spartan next to the c55 and s4. Option out the s40 and it's 36K. The audi weighs over 600lb more than the volvo in this comparison(!). Another factor is the merc and the audi in this test are both automatics, while the volvo is a stick. Nonetheless, i agree that the s40awd is already a darn good performer, and if there is a type R, i'd go test drive it in a heartbeat. Now, the new 3 is already nearly a second faster to sixty, and i will say it is definitely more fun to drive, at least to me. A 330i stickers at 36,995. A similarly equipped s40 stickers for 34,478 ( premium, climate, upgraded stereo, xenons, DSTC, convenience package. The BMW doesn't have AWD. Volvo is discontinuing their 3 years of free service next year, BMW has 4 years. Unless i really wanted AWD, i'd pony up the extra 2.5K and get the BMW. I'd probably make it back in resale later. But that's because i'm the sort of person who loves to slide cars around corners and crazy things like that. dave
